R. Jelínek Fernet Liqueur is a Czech herbal liqueur produced near the spa town of Luhačovice, a region with a long history of herbalism and distillation. In the fernet style its recipe rests on a carefully balanced selection of aromatic herbs and spices that give the liqueur its distinctive, tart character. Bottled at 38%, it sits firmly at the bitter, digestif end of the herbal category.
The nose is slightly minty, marked by intense herbal aromas, aniseed, cloves, sultanas and fresh mint, while the palate is spicy, tart and complex with pronounced herbal notes and a fine bitterness, closing dry and long with a slightly bitter aftertaste. For the trade that bitter, herbal backbone is the point: it adds depth, dryness and an aromatic bitterness that balances sweeter ingredients in a mix. It is traditionally served neat and well chilled as a digestif or after dinner liqueur, and works as a strong component in selected cocktails, particularly after hearty meals.
